Handover — Thornquist to next on-call. Flaky DNS on the Mistvale resolvers: intermittent NXDOMAIN for internal zones, roughly every 40 minutes, suspect stale negative caching on resolver pair B. Packet captures attached to the incident doc for security review. If resolver B needs a sealed config reload, the recovery passphrase is below.

strongbox words: fraath-isteth

For this week's sync: Retenzo, our data-retention sweeper, touches three stores. It reads policy definitions from the policy catalog, scans the primary records store for expired rows, and writes tombstone entries to the audit ledger. Sweeps run nightly at 02:10; each batch is capped at 50k deletions to limit replication lag. Last week's incident came from the sweeper holding long transactions on the records store, so batch timing is under review. To inspect sweep state directly, use the catalog connection string below.

replica DSN, yahaf-yagaf: mongodb://tamath_svc:a2netSk3RZMuTj@db-d084.novacsoft.internal:5432/ralmir

Welcome to the Tarnwell Data Team!

Before you push any SQL, a word on linting. We run sqlsift in CI against everything under /warehouse/models. The big rules: uppercase keywords, no SELECT *, explicit JOIN conditions, and every file ends with a trailing newline (yes, it fails builds otherwise). You can run sqlsift locally with the config in the repo root; don't hand-edit the ruleset, propose changes in #data-standards instead. To unlock the shared lint-rules vault on first setup, enter the passphrase below.

unlock words, yawig-kagef: gordor-holvan-ulaael-pramir-ulaiel-tamdor